Default when do gears start to hurt

i have a 2001 camaro z28with auto trans. I was hoping to do something so i can get a little quicker from lets say a 25 to 40 roll. I heard gears help alot but would it be agood idea for me to get them if most of my races are from a roll up to like 100-110

Yeah you should be fine with gears, they will actually help you get up to that point alot faster. You can change out to 3.73s since your an auto, or you can also check out 4.10s. But im not sure how autos react to 4.10s so i say 3.73s. Hopefully someone who has an A4 with gears can chime in with some info.
